Output bb423a106b46c9232beb4b154d8b4f432c3db8c85605a45d6742dfa8bde07ab7:1

value
1403976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f1aaaf1861e28bc11a465021ceeca9770d006ac OP_EQUAL
address
334t1L2PTF8dq6rxWdvApBFQkQoEZrT4gf
transaction
bb423a106b46c9232beb4b154d8b4f432c3db8c85605a45d6742dfa8bde07ab7
confirmations
287619
spent
true